Output e901f65c19bdd684b70dd9b6540808f10952ac7f3a9aa3321e29ee61f0b79f78:0

value
3128
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1757c5f87c18f47c333d3f86d87ae2176090725af49eb250543a7994b359fa6a
address
bc1pzatut7rurr68cvea87rds7hzzasfquj67j0ty5z58fuefv6elf4qnx0yua
transaction
e901f65c19bdd684b70dd9b6540808f10952ac7f3a9aa3321e29ee61f0b79f78
spent
true